Address

0x8B6Fa4E85AE126DD7297e53c6d35098dE484C80E

0.003592891982327877 ETH
107745.85 IDR

Including Tokens

0.231368 ETH
6938406.19 IDR

Confirmed
Balance0.003592891982327877 ETH107745.85 IDR
Transactions9
Non-contract Transactions2
Internal Transactions0
Nonce1
ContractQuantityValueTransfers#
DevvE654 DEVVE6830660.34 IDR(0.227775 ETH)8